Tornado damage recovery services involve assessing the extent of destruction caused by severe storms and implementing repairs to restore a property’s safety and stability. These services typically include debris removal, structural assessments, and repairs to damaged roofs, walls, and foundations. Service providers work to ensure that homes and buildings are safe to occupy again by addressing issues such as broken windows, torn siding, and compromised structural elements. The goal is to help property owners return their homes to a secure condition as quickly and efficiently as possible after a storm has caused significant damage.
Many tornado damage recovery services focus on solving problems related to structural integrity, water intrusion, and aesthetic damage. Tornadoes can leave properties with shattered windows, torn roofing materials, and compromised walls, which can lead to further issues like water leaks, mold growth, and pest entry if not addressed promptly. Service providers can help stabilize the property, remove hazardous debris, and perform repairs that prevent further deterioration. This comprehensive approach helps property owners avoid more costly repairs down the line and ensures their homes meet safety standards.

The overview below groups typical Tornado Damage Recovery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cary,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many minor tornado-related damages, such as shingle replacements or small siding fixes, typically cost between $250 and $600. Most routine jobs fall into this range, depending on the extent of the damage and material costs.
Moderate Damage - Repair projects involving larger sections of roof or siding, or multiple areas, often range from $600 to $2,500. These are common for homes experiencing moderate storm impacts in the Cary area.
Major Repairs - Extensive damage requiring significant repairs or partial replacements can cost between $2,500 and $5,000. Projects in this range are less frequent but are necessary for more severe storm effects.
Full Replacement - Complete roof or siding replacements due to severe tornado damage can exceed $5,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ching $10,000 or more. Such cases are less common but can be essential for restoring heavily impacted proper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
